Political Science Major

The Political Science major is ideal for students with broad interests in American politics, international relations, comparative politics, political theory, and law. Students are prepared for a wide range of government and corporate careers, including law school and graduate school.

Civic & Nonprofit Leadership Option

The Civic and Nonprofit Leadership option emphasizes US public affairs, public policy, and nonprofits. Students gain valuable technical skills, such as leadership, policy research, and public budgeting, and are well-prepared for public sector, nonprofit, and urban planning careers.

International Studies Option

The International Studies option emphasizes international relations and comparative politics, including interdisciplinary courses and a second language. This option provides a well-rounded degree to prepare students for careers in global politics, diplomacy, development, and advocacy.

Political Science Honors

Qualified students can graduate with departmental honors by writing an honors thesis, mentored by a faculty member, and completing a graduate seminar in Political Science.

Accelerated Graduate Program

Qualified students may apply to take graduate classes beginning in their junior year, double-counting up to 9 credits, and allowing students to earn a B.A. and M.A. in Political Science in about 5 years

Joint B.A./J.D. with Northern Illinois University

Qualified students may enroll in a program that allowing them to earn both a B.A. in Political Science from EIU and a law degree from Northern Illinois University in 6 years, instead of the customary 7 years.
